> Yes, I think that according to the GPL, any change that IBM makes in
> existing code would have to be also GPL. Now if they write their own
> separate piece, say a module, I think they can use any license they want.
> OSS does not distribute the source for their commercial sound stuff, do
> they?

Linus has given permission for third party modules that are not source
to be distributed providing they use the existing modules apis. I've not
seen a single binary only module thats actually remotely popular with its
user base other than the commercial OSS sound modules.
